Class CookingAndServingHandler

java.lang.Object
com.csse3200.game.components.Component
com.csse3200.game.events.CookingAndServingHandler

public class CookingAndServingHandler extends Component
  • Constructor Details

    • CookingAndServingHandler

      public CookingAndServingHandler(GameTime timeSource)
  • Method Details

    • isCooking

      public boolean isCooking()
    • create

      public void create()
      Description copied from class: Component
      Called when the entity is created and registered. Initial logic such as calls to GetComponent should be made here, not in the constructor which is called before an entity is finished.
      Overrides:
      create in class Component
    • startCooking

      public void startCooking()
    • stopCooking

      public void stopCooking()
    • serveMeal

      public void serveMeal()
    • deleteMeal

      public void deleteMeal()
    • updateState

      public void updateState()
    • isServed

      public boolean isServed()